I would be angry if you get into bed with dirty shoes Aku akan marah jika kamu naik ke ranjang dengan sepatu kotor
How to say “I would be angry if you get into bed with dirty shoes” in Indonesian? “Aku akan marah jika kamu naik ke ranjang dengan sepatu kotor”. Sentence info.

Sentence Formation:
– "Aku" means "I".
– "akan" is a future tense marker, indicating "will" or "would".
– "marah" means "angry".
– "jika" means "if".
– "kamu" means "you".
– "naik ke ranjang" means "get into bed" (literally "climb to bed").
– "dengan" means "with".
– "sepatu kotor" means "dirty shoes".

Tips to Remember:
– Focus on the conditional structure: "Akan marah jika" (Will be angry if).
– Remember that in Indonesian, personal pronouns like "Aku" can often be omitted if the context is clear, but they're included here for emphasis.
– "Naik ke" can be a tricky phrase; "naik" is often used for movement upwards or getting onto something, like getting into a vehicle or bed.

Alternate Ways to Say It:
– "Saya akan marah kalau kamu naik ke tempat tidur dengan sepatu yang kotor."
– "Akan membuatku marah kalau kamu masuk ke ranjang dengan sepatu kotor."
– "Aku pasti marah jika kamu berada di ranjang dengan sepatu yang kotor."
